I have attached a photo of mine of a 6 week old black leopard cub, it maybe of help to have a clear photo of one if anyone has not seen one before. I think it could be mistaken at times for a domestic cat from a distance but the size of the paws are a good clue to what it is.
This is a male cub who was very adventurous, more than his twin sister. He was born in August 2006 and is bigger than his dad now and as far as I know he and his sister will be living at Exmoor Zoo from early 2008.
